Transaction 34c23598ff761864021eb06bb22e9eac45a33c66751e6f1e4d4565ebdbedac96

1 Input
2 Outputs
  • 34c23598ff761864021eb06bb22e9eac45a33c66751e6f1e4d4565ebdbedac96:0
  • value  102620
    address  18QpsS7KXdrtbc1w4FruhnqhCByeNRRkF9
  • 34c23598ff761864021eb06bb22e9eac45a33c66751e6f1e4d4565ebdbedac96:1
  • value  2290374
    address  1DGU8fUMYJPkWeRyn4x3mNL3HzJ2DZyirA